Please enter a search term.
Please enter a search term

Shirts in size 16

Make a statement at the office or have all eyes on you at your next formal daytime or evening event with our beautiful collection of smart yet feminine shirts. From casual ¾ sleeve jersey shirts to pair with colourful cropped trousers for a weekend look that's ready for a barbecue or garden party, to pretty floral print shirts with classic collars that will instantly refresh your workwear wardrobe. Our collection of women's shirts has something for everyone and with a wide variety of prints, shapes and colours available, you're sure to find your next wardrobe must have right here!

524 items
new-price
Blue Textured Spot Floral Print Frill Top
Green Floral Print Ruffle Front Top
Black Geometric Print Twist Stretch Top
Pink Floral High Neck Keyhole Detail Top
Cream Ruched Lace Trim Top
Dusk Pack
new-price
Green Abstract Print Sleeveless Button Blouse
Purple Abstract Print Halter Neck Top
Blue Sleeveless Floral Print Blouse
White Cotton Textured Spot Blouse
Blue Floral Halterneck Gathered Top
Green Chiffon Sleeve Stretch Top
Black Bow Detail Floral Shirred Top
Brown Tie Dye Print Relaxed Shirt
Brown Petite Tropical Print Shirt
Roman Petite
Red Spot Print Relaxed Woven Top
Pink Floral Print Burnout Top
Green Abstract Floral Print Button Twist Top
Blue Stripe Print Pleat Detail Top
Black Ditsy Floral Lace Trim Top
Dusk Pack
new-price
Multi Sleeveless Floral Tie Front Stretch Top
Multi Textured Palm Print Stretch Blouse
Pink Petite Spot Print Lace Tunic Top
Roman Petite
Blue Leaf Print Pintuck Swing Stretch Top
Green Geometric Print Collared Blouse
Pink Embroidered Crinkle Cotton Blouse
new-price
Blue Floral Hem Detail Sleeveless Top
White Pointelle Knitted Vest Top
new-price
Blue Tie Dye Stretch Jersey Halterneck Top
new-price
Blue Cotton Floral Print Broderie Crinkle Blouse
Purple Ombre Embroidered Cotton Crinkle Blouse
Green Wave Burnout Print Stretch Tie Top
new-price
Blue Floral High Neck Wrap Vest Top
Blue Sleeveless Swirl Print Pleat Front Top
Pink Embroidered Stripe Notch Neck Top
Pink Open Knit Cotton Blend Tunic Top
Blue Abstract Print Sleeveless Smock Top
Grey Stripe Print Stretch Vest Top
Dusk Pack
Black Ruched Detail Stretch Vest Top
Dusk Pack
White Swirl Print Pleated Halterneck Top
Blue Plisse Stretch Top
Purple Floral Asymmetric Top
Blue Abstract Print Overlay Top
Blue Burnout Tie Sleeve Overlay Top
Pink Floral Print Pleat Front Overshirt
Black Pointelle Cotton Knit Vest
new-price
Purple Sleeveless Floral Button Detail Top
White Animal Jacquard Frill Stretch T-Shirt
Pink Floral Hem Detail Sleeveless Top
Multi Asymmetric Sleeveless Vest Top
Multi Petite Embroidered Cotton Smock Top
Roman Petite
Pink Ditsy Floral Lace Trim Top
Dusk Pack
Blue Abstract Print Woven Pleat Front Top
Pink Eyelet Detail Embroidered Crinkle Blouse
Blue Floral Print Button Detail Top
Black Textured Spot Button Up Blouse
Green Floral Print Sleeveless Button Blouse
Blue Aztec Print Shirred Stretch Halterneck Top
Blue Textured Sleeveless Blouse
Metallic Shimmer Crochet Tie Stretch Knit Jumper
Black Stripe Ribbed Stretch Racer Vest
Dusk Pack
Pink Floral Print Chiffon Cami Top
Red Floral Print Wrap Stretch Top
Green Sleeveless Button Detail Vest
new-price
Red Spot Print Pleated Stretch Top
Blue Aztec Burnout Print Sleeveless Stretch Top
Blue Sleeveless Embroidered Cotton Blouse
Green Floral Hem Detail Sleeveless Top
Green Paisley Print Stretch Jersey Wrap Top
Blue Petite Linen Blend Sleeveless Blouse
Roman Petite
Green Petite Stretch Hanky Hem Vest Top
Roman Petite
Blue Abstract Print Ruched Tunic Top
Cream Pointelle Tassel Detail Knit Top
Black Sleeveless Textured Animal Print Top
Black Leaf Print Double Layer Vest Top
Yellow Spot Print Twist Neck Top
new-price
Multi Border Print Button Detail Shirt
Blue Abstract Print Jersey Top
Black Geometric Print Crinkle Collared Blouse
Green Palm Leaf Tropical Print Sleeveless Blouse
Black Ruched Twist Cowl Neck Stretch Top
Dusk Pack
new-price
Blue Floral Print High Neck Top
new-price
Pink Tile Print Button Through Blouse
Green Cross Back V-Neck Camisole
Red Embroidered Peplum Cotton Vest
White Ditsy Floral Print Sleeveless Blouse
Green Relaxed Graphic Print Shirt
Dusk Pack
Orange Abstract Print Tie Detail Smock Top
Pink Plisse Stretch Top
Black Floral Print Button Through Blouse
Black Border Print Zip Detail Stretch Top
Multi Floral Print Frill Detail Blouse
Orange Paisley Print Button Detail Top
Blue Aztec Print Pleated Stretch Top
Blue Petite Plain Sleeveless Top
Roman Petite
Cream Raw Hem Shirt Jacket
Dusk Pack
Red Floral Print 3/4 Sleeve Longline Top
new-price
Blue Floral Print Chiffon Hem T-Shirt
Green Abstract Print Textured Shirt
Blue Sleeveless Textured Swirl Print Top
Green Textured Sleeveless Stretch Top
Green Floral Print Smock Tunic Top
Blue Metallic Print Chiffon Blouse
Pink Petite Cold Shoulder Paisley Hanky Hem Top
Roman Petite
Blue Abstract Print 3/4 Sleeve Longline Top
Black Abstract Stretch Jersey Tunic Top
new-price
Black Relaxed Floral Print Shirt
Dusk Pack
White Floral Print Ruffle Front Top
Pink Ruched Twist Cowl Neck Stretch Top
Dusk Pack
Green Wave Print Pleated Stretch Top
Red Patchwork Print Stretch Jersey Shirt
Blue Textured Spot Print Blouson Top
Green Ditsy Bow Tie Sleeve Top
Purple Textured Polka Dot Blouse
Yellow Floral Print Halter Neck Top
Blue Embroidered Peplum Cotton Vest
Blue Petite Floral Print Chiffon Overlay Top
Roman Petite
Multi Pleated Halter Neck Top
Red Necklace Trim Jersey 3/4 Sleeve Chiffon Top
Black Sleeveless Swirl Print Pleat Front Top
Pink Petite Floral Twist Neck Top
Roman Petite